What to check before for buildings with low historical violations near the M10 bus in All Upper West Side

  • Confirm the match: the building should be in the M10 bus service area you expect for your commute, not just “nearby.”
  • Review the low-historic-violations signal on the building page, and still ask the management team about current maintenance practices and recent cycles of work.
  • Compare lease basics on each building listing page: rent terms, renewal language, and what’s included (heat, hot water, utilities).
  • Check for move-in costs beyond rent: security deposit, any broker fee, and any required fees tied to move-in or administrative processing.
  • If you’re planning a longer stay, ask about practical operations (package handling, laundry access, and response times) since these affect day-to-day living more than rules on paper.
